HW not detecting Launchpad Mk1
I originally had a Launchpad MK1 but eventually change it for a Mk2 for its increased illumination. I kept the Mk1 for a later occasion. Many HW versions later, I would like to add it to my current configuration. I have connected it up and it appears in Device Manager under Other Devices as "Lauchpad". HW does not detect this. If I disconnect the Launch Pad MK1 lead it disappears from the Device Manager. Can someone help. It has to be a simple problem.

Note that Hauptwerk doesn't support 'hot-plugging' devices, so it's important that you exist Hauptwerk before plugging in, or unplugging, any audio/MIDI/USB devices. Please try:
- Exit Hauptwerk if it's running.
- Unplug the Launchpad Mk1 and plug it in again (which will reboot it). If connecting via a USB hub, make sure it's a good-quality model with a dedicated mains power supply, since Launchpads probably draw a fair amount of current.
- Re-launch Hauptwerk.
- Go to the MIDI Ports screen in Hauptwerk. You should see columns for the Launchpad Mk1 listed. Tick its column on both the "MIDI IN ports" tab, and on the "MIDI OUT ports" tab.
Does that solve it?

Perhaps Windows is putting it (or some other USB device to sleep). Try following these instructions (from the Hauptwerk advanced user guide) to prevent Windows putting things to sleep (especially its option for putting USB devices to sleep):

If that doesn't solve it, perhaps try a different USB cable, and if that still doesn't solve it perhaps the device is malfunctioning erratically.• Disable all Windows power-saving functions, including the options for putting USB ports/devices to sleep. For example, on Windows 10 you would use 'Windows Control Panel | System | Power and sleep | Additional power settings', select the 'High performance' power plan, then click its 'Change plan settings | Change advanced power settings', then make sure that the settings are set as follows:
Sleep: Hibernate after = Never (for 'plugged in' if present)
USB settings: USB selective suspend setting = Disabled (for 'plugged in' if present)
PCI Express: Link state power management = Off (for 'plugged in' if present)
